Effects of Dietary Inclusion of Astaxanthin on Growth, Muscle Pigmentation and Antioxidant Capacity of Juvenile Rainbow Trout (Oncorhynchus mykiss) 원문보기

Preventive nutrition and food science, v.21 no.3, 2016년, pp.281 - 288  

Rahman, Md Mostafizur (Department of Marine Bioscience and Technology, Gangneung-Wonju National University) ,  Khosravi, Sanaz (Department of Marine Bioscience and Technology, Gangneung-Wonju National University) ,  Chang, Kyung Hoon (CJ Food Ingredients Research and Developement Center, CJ CheilJedang) ,  Lee, Sang-Min (Department of Marine Bioscience and Technology, Gangneung-Wonju National University)

Abstract AI-Helper 아이콘AI-Helper

This study was designed to investigate the effects of dietary astaxanthin levels on growth performance, feed utilization, muscle pigmentation, and antioxidant capacity in juvenile rainbow trout.   • Furthermore, to the best of our knowledge, there has not been a study that investigates the effects of different dietary levels of Carophyll pink™, as the major commercially available source of dietary astaxanthin, on the antioxidant status of these fish species in terms of plasma antioxidant enzymes and/ or plasma, and liver radical scavenging activities. Therefore, the aim of this study was to evaluate the effects of dietary levels of astaxanthin on the growth performance, feed utilization, muscle pigmentation, and antioxidant status of juvenile rainbow trout.
